GENE - CHEMICAL INTERACTIONS REPORT

RGD ID: 628626
Species: Rattus norvegicus
RGD Object: Gene
Symbol: Cyp3a23-3a1
Name: cytochrome P450, family 3, subfamily a, polypeptide 23-polypeptide 1
Acc ID: CHEBI:34648
Term: clofibric acid
Definition: A monocarboxylic acid that is isobutyric acid substituted at position 2 by a p-chlorophenoxy group. It is a metabolite of the drug clofibrate.
Chemical ID: MESH:D002995
Note: Use of the qualifier "multiple interactions" designates that the annotated interaction is comprised of a complex set of reactions and/or regulatory events, possibly involving additional chemicals and/or gene products.
